Intro
Maintaining a home's pipes system is crucial for making certain the comfort, benefit, and safety of its passengers. From preventing expensive water damages to making certain access to clean drinking water, regular upkeep can go a long way in preserving the stability of your plumbing facilities.
Regular Inspection and Upkeep
One of the most crucial aspects of plumbing maintenance is carrying out routine examinations. Look for leaks, leaks, and indicators of corrosion in pipes, components, and home appliances. Dealing with minor issues early can assist prevent more considerable troubles down the line.
Sump Pump Upkeep
If your home has a sump pump, see to it it is functioning appropriately, especially throughout heavy rainfall. Examine the pump regularly and keep the pit devoid of particles to prevent clogs.
Checking Water Pressure
High water stress can damage pipes and components, while reduced pressure can indicate underlying pipes concerns. Utilize a stress gauge to monitor water pressure and readjust it as needed.
Maintaining Outdoor Pipes
Throughout the warmer months, examine exterior taps, hose pipes, and sprinkler systems for leaks or damages. Shut down outside water resources before the very first freeze to avoid burst pipelines.
Informing Family Members
Get everyone in your house associated with pipes upkeep. Teach member of the family how to identify leakages, turned off the water, and use plumbing components sensibly.
Specialist Plumbing Assessments
In addition to do it yourself upkeep tasks, timetable routine inspections with a qualified plumbing. A specialist can determine potential concerns early and recommend safety nets to maintain your pipes system in leading condition.
Water Heater Maintenance
Water heaters must be flushed consistently to eliminate sediment accumulation and keep performance. Check the temperature level and stress safety valve for leakages and make sure correct ventilation around the unit.
Protecting Against Pipes Emergency Situations
While some pipes emergencies are unavoidable, lots of can be prevented with correct upkeep. Know where your primary water shut-off shutoff lies and exactly how to utilize it in case of an emergency situation. Take into consideration installing water leakage detection devices for included defense.
Dealing With Minor Issues Quickly
Don't ignore tiny plumbing issues like trickling taps or running commodes. Also minor leaks can throw away substantial quantities of water in time and result in expensive water damage. Addressing these concerns immediately can conserve you money over time.
Maintaining Drainpipes and Drains
Clogged drains and sewer lines can lead to back-ups and costly repair services. To stop this, prevent flushing non-biodegradable items down the toilet and usage drain screens to capture hair and particles. Consistently flush drains pipes with warm water and cooking soft drink to maintain them clear.
Securing Pipelines from Cold
In chillier climates, frozen pipes can be a considerable worry throughout the cold weather. To avoid pipes from freezing and bursting, shield subjected pipelines, separate outside tubes, and keep faucets leaking throughout freezing temperature levels.
Water Top Quality Testing
Regularly examine your water high quality to ensure it fulfills safety standards. Consider installing a water filtration system if your water contains pollutants or has an undesirable preference or odor.
Waste Disposal Unit Upkeep
To maintain your garbage disposal running efficiently, stay clear of putting fibrous or starchy foods, grease, or non-food products away. Regularly grind ice and citrus peels to clean and ventilate the disposal.
Verdict
Keeping your home's pipes system does not need to be made complex, but it does call for persistance and regular focus. By complying with these tips and staying proactive, you can avoid costly repairs, conserve water, and guarantee the durability of your plumbing framework.
Top Tips for Maintaining Your Plumbing System
Regular Inspections
To maintain a healthy plumbing system in your Sydney home, you should have it inspected regularly by a professional plumber. The plumber will check for leaks, clogs and other potential problems that can cause damage to your pipes and fixtures during an inspection. This can help you avoid costly repairs down the road and ensure that your plumbing system continues to function properly. Proper Use of Drains
To keep your plumbing system in good shape, you should use your drains for the correct purpose. Avoid flushing things like wipes and feminine hygiene products down the toilet because these items can cause clogs that damage pipes. You should avoid putting grease or large food particles down your kitchen sink because these can create clogs as well.
Water Pressure Maintenance
Maintaining water pressure is very important for the health/strength of your plumbing system. In fact, high water pressure can cause damage to your pipes and fixtures, while low water pressure can make it difficult to use your faucets and showers. Water Heater Maintenance
A water heater is a key part of your home’s plumbing system. Regular maintenance such as flushing the tank, checking the pressure relief valve, and checking the temperature can help extend its lifespan and ensure that it continues to provide hot water when you need it. If you’re experiencing problems with your water heater, have it checked by a professional plumber; he or she can diagnose and repair any issues.
Leak Detection
Leaks are a common problem for homeowners and can cause significant damage to your home if not addressed promptly. Regular inspections, proper use of your plumbing system, and knowing how to detect leaks can help prevent them from occurring. Signs of a leak may include a drop in water pressure, an increase in your water bill, or hearing running water even when all faucets are off. If you suspect a leak, it is important to have it inspected and repaired promptly to prevent further damage.
